SharpLink (SBET) Declines on Ethereum Drop

We recently published Wall Street’s 10 Worst Performing Stocks. SharpLink Gaming, Inc. (NASDAQ:SBET) is one of the worst performers on Wednesday.

SharpLink declined by 5.8 percent on Wednesday to close at $25.81 apiece as investors turned cautious amid the drop in Ethereum prices during the day.

As of this writing, prices of Ethereum, which SharpLink Gaming, Inc. (NASDAQ:SBET) hoards in its treasury, were down by 3.17 percent at $3,629.59 apiece as market experts predict the cryptocurrency to pull back to the $3,400 support level.

SharpLink Gaming, Inc. (NASDAQ:SBET) traders took the comment negatively, especially after the company reported last Tuesday that it hiked its ETH ownership in ETH to 360,807 following the purchase of another 79,949 ETH. The cryptocurrencies were bought at an average price of $3,238 apiece.

ETH concentration rose to 3.06, up 53 percent since the company launched its digital treasury strategy.

The lump sum transaction made SharpLink Gaming, Inc. (NASDAQ:SBET) the largest ETH owner to date.

According to SharpLink Gaming, Inc. (NASDAQ:SBET) another $96.6 million of proceeds from a recent share sale have yet to be deployed to purchase more ETH.
